css - 在 Float+margin+padding 上使用 css 定位有什么坏处和好处?

标签 css

我们可以在不使用 float 的情况下使用 CSS 定位制作跨浏览器的 css 布局吗? usin css positioning over Float+margin+padding 的优缺点是什么?我想让布局与所有 A 级浏览器和 IE6 兼容吗?在 Dreamweaver 中,我们有一个图层功能可以快速制作 css 布局,但它使用了绝对位置。这个技术不好吗?

最佳答案

如果您不关心浏览器的外观是否比您设计的要大或小,那么绝对定位非常好。 :)

但是,在大多数情况下,如果您正在设计可能在 17"- 30"显示器上的浏览器,那么它可能是全屏的,那么 float 是有帮助的。

现在,如果您正在更改位置以动态缩放到窗口大小,并且可以处理调整大小,那么绝对会很好地工作。

如果你想摆脱 float ,我认为绝对定位会比它值得做的更多工作。

关于css - 在 Float+margin+padding 上使用 css 定位有什么坏处和好处?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/1692090/

相关文章:

javascript - raphael Canvas 图像在 IE8 中无法正确显示

javascript - 使用ionic的angular js无限滚动问题

jquery - 覆盖默认的 jquery css?

html - 无法使用 css 加载背景图像

javascript - 一旦满足特定条件就停止动画 - Jquery

javascript - 图像上方div的HTML定位

html - Google 字体在我使用 Mac 的网站上呈现效果不佳

php - 尝试创建干净的 url 时 css 消失

javascript - IE表格单元格中的 float DIV

javascript - 基金会 6 个站点 - 下拉列表 : Pane Doesn't Open on Click